Read-only custom fields lose their value when cloning a record

Description

When cloning a record in Salesforce, custom fields that are set to Read-Only for the cloning user do not retain their values in the newly cloned record. The cloned record shows those fields as blank.
For example:

  • A record contains a read-only text field with the value "Test."
  • A user without Edit access to that field clones the record.
  • In the newly cloned record, the read-only field is blank.

This behavior applies when fields are set to Read-Only via Field Level Security (FLS) or via Page Layout settings.
 

Résolution

This is currently working as designed since read-only fields are not sent to the server when a case is cloned. This doesn't affect admins since they have the "Edit Read-Only fields" or users who have edit access via Field Level Security and Page Layout settings.

Note: This impact will be effective when the fields are set to "Read Only" from Field Level Security as well as Page layout.
